Application of Evolutionary Algorithms for Multi-objective Optimization in VLSI and Embedded Systems

  • 出版商: Springer
  • 出版日期: 2014-09-02
  • 售價: $4,280
  • 貴賓價: 9.5$4,066
  • 語言: 英文
  • 頁數: 174
  • 裝訂: Hardcover
  • ISBN: 8132219570
  • ISBN-13: 9788132219576
  • 相關分類: 嵌入式系統VLSIAlgorithms-data-structures
  • 海外代購書籍(需單獨結帳)

商品描述

This book describes how evolutionary algorithms (EA), including genetic algorithms (GA) and particle swarm optimization (PSO) can be utilized for solving multi-objective optimization problems in the area of embedded and VLSI system design. Many complex engineering optimization problems can be modelled as multi-objective formulations. This book provides an introduction to multi-objective optimization using meta-heuristic algorithms, GA and PSO and how they can be applied to problems like hardware/software partitioning in embedded systems, circuit partitioning in VLSI, design of operational amplifiers in analog VLSI, design space exploration in high-level synthesis, delay fault testing in VLSI testing and scheduling in heterogeneous distributed systems. It is shown how, in each case, the various aspects of the EA, namely its representation and operators like crossover, mutation, etc, can be separately formulated to solve these problems. This book is intended for design engineers and researchers in the field of VLSI and embedded system design. The book introduces the multi-objective GA and PSO in a simple and easily understandable way that will appeal to introductory readers.

商品描述(中文翻譯)

本書描述了如何利用進化算法(EA),包括遺傳算法(GA)和粒子群優化(PSO),來解決嵌入式和VLSI系統設計領域中的多目標優化問題。許多複雜的工程優化問題可以建模為多目標問題。本書介紹了使用元啟發式算法、GA和PSO進行多目標優化的基礎知識,以及它們如何應用於嵌入式系統中的硬體/軟體分割、VLSI中的電路分割、類比VLSI中運算放大器的設計、高層次綜合中的設計空間探索、VLSI測試中的延遲故障測試和異質分佈系統中的排程等問題。本書展示了如何分別對EA的各個方面(如表示和運算子,如交叉、突變等)進行獨立的建模,以解決這些問題。本書適用於VLSI和嵌入式系統設計領域的設計工程師和研究人員。本書以簡單易懂的方式介紹了多目標GA和PSO,適合初學者閱讀。